An APA-styled citation plugin for the lektor static content management system (https://getlektor.com).
## Preparations
Install the plugin by
```
lektor plugin add lektor-citation
```
or by copying this repository into the _packages_-folder of your lektor-project.
Create an _citation.ini_ in its _configs_-folder:
```
[Bibtex]
file = Literature.bib
[default]
priority = url
link = /for-example/link-to-your/biblioprahy
```
And put a _Literature.bib_ BibTex-file into the project's _assets_-folder respectively.
## Jinja_env
### Bibliography
To get a formated output of your whole BibTex library you can either
1. Use method citation\_short\_output in the template of your literature page. It creates an unordered list of entries.
```
<ul id="literatur">
{% for entry in citation_entries() %}
{{ citation_short_output(entry)|decode|safe }}
{% endfor %}
</ul>
```
2. Use method citation\_full\_output instead. This creates a more complete html-output for every entry.
```
{% for entry in citation_entries() %}
{{ citation_full_output(entry)|decode|safe }}
{% endfor %}
```
produces
```
<h2>{title}</h2><h3>{authors} ({pubYear})</h3>
<p>{note}</p>
<dl class="literature">
<dt class="edition"></dt>
<dd>{edition}</dd>
<dt class="editors"></dt>
<dd>{editors}</dd>
<dt class="pages"></dt>
<dd>{pages}</dd>
<dt class="issbn"></dt>
<dd>{issbn}</dd>
<dt class="publisher"></dt>
<dd>{publisher}</dd>
</dl>
```
3. You may also use the citation\_entry method in combination with [pybtex*s __Entry__-class](https://docs.pybtex.org/api/parsing.html#pybtex.database.Entry). For example:
```
<ul>
{% for entry in citation_entries() %}
<li>{{ citation_entry(entry).fields['title'] |decode }}</li>
{% endfor %}
</ul>
```
This creates an unordered list of all the titles of your bibtex file.
Of course you can also use citation\_entry without a loop and put any id of your bibtex entries into it as parameter.
Alternatively to the pybtex methods you can use the following **jinja_env globals**:
citation_authors_short(entry)
citation_authors_full(entry)
citation_editors_short(entry)
citation_editors_full(entry)
citation_pubYear(entry)
citation_edition(entry)
citation_publisher(entry)
citation_title(entry)
citation_url(entry)
citation_issbn(entry)
citation_pages(entry)
citation_note(entry)
### In-text Cites
To cite a certain entry in your texts you can use the **jinja_env globals**:
citation_full_cite(id, link="")
citation_full_citeNP(id, link="")
Both methods create a complete hyperlink inside your text for the entry with _id_. You may give it any url to the _link_ parameter to e.g. link it to your bibliography page. The NP in the second stands for _No Parantheses_. So you'll receive e.g.
AuthorI & AuthorII (2019)
or
(AuthorI & AuthorII, 2019)
#### link parameter
Which url is used for your citation's link depends on what you set in the _citation.ini_ file.
* If you set _priority_ in the _default_ section to __url__ the link is set to the value of the _url_ field of the entry.
* If there's no value in it the default-link you may set with _link_ in the same section is used.
* If you set the _link_ parameter of the function it overwrites the former options.
Thanks to the **lektor-jinja-content** plugin which is a dependency of this plugin you might also use the globals inside your markdown or html contents, too.

# -*- coding: utf-8 -*-
import os
from pylatexenc.latex2text import LatexNodes2Text
from pybtex.database import parse_file
from lektor.pluginsystem import Plugin
class CitationPlugin(Plugin):
name = 'lektor-citation'
description = u'This Plugin should extend lektor with APA-styled citations using bibtex files. It was based on the known lektor-bibtex-support plugin by arunpersaud.'
def __init__(self, env, id):
super().__init__(env, id)
config = self.get_config()
self.bibfile = config.get('Bibtex.file', []).strip()
self.default_prio = config.get('default.priority', []).strip()
self.default_link = config.get('default.link', []).strip()
self.bib_data = parse_file(os.path.join(env.root_path, 'assets', self.bibfile))
def citation_entries(self):
return self.bib_data.entries
def citation_entry(self, id):
return self.bib_data.entries[id]
def get_people_full(self, lAuthor):
authors = ""
n = 1
for author in lAuthor:
first = author.first_names
if len(first) > 0 :
for item in first:
authors += "{i} ".format(i = str(item))
middle = author.middle_names
if len(middle) > 0 :
for item in middle:
authors += "{i} ".format(i = str(item))
prelast = author.prelast_names
if len(prelast) > 0:
for item in prelast:
authors += "{i} ".format(i = str(item))
authors += str(author.last_names[0])
if len(lAuthor) > 1:
if n == (len(lAuthor) - 1):
authors += " & "
elif n < (len(lAuthor) -1):
authors += ", "
n = n + 1
return authors
def get_people_short(self, lAuthor):
authors = ""
n = 1
for author in lAuthor:
prelast = author.prelast_names
if len(prelast) > 0:
for item in prelast:
authors += "{i} ".format(i = str(item))
authors += str(author.last_names[0])
first = author.first_names
if len(first) > 0 :
authors += ","
for item in first:
authors += " {i}.".format(i = str(item[:1]))
middle = author.middle_names
if len(middle) > 0 :
for item in middle:
authors += " {i}.".format(i = str(item[:1]))
if len(lAuthor) > 1:
if n == (len(lAuthor) - 1):
authors += " & "
elif n < (len(lAuthor) -1):
authors += ", "
n = n + 1
return authors
def get_pubYear(self, e):
if "year" in e.fields.keys():
year = e.fields['year']
else:
year = ""
return year
def get_title(self, e):
if "title" in e.fields.keys():
title = e.fields['title']
else:
title = ""
return title
def get_edition(self, e):
if 'edition' in e.fields.keys():
edition = e.fields['edition']
edition = " ({ed}. Ed.)".format(ed = edition)
else:
edition = ""
return edition
def get_publisher(self, e):
if 'publisher' in e.fields.keys():
publisher = e.fields['publisher']
if 'address' in e.fields.keys():
location = e.fields['address']
publisher = " {location}: {publisher}.".format(location = location, publisher = publisher)
elif publisher:
publisher = " {publisher}.".format(publisher = publisher)
else:
publisher = ""
return publisher
def get_pages(self, e):
if 'pages' in e.fields.keys():
pages = e.fields['pages']
else:
pages = ""
return pages
def get_issbn(self, e):
if 'issbn' in e.fields.keys():
issbn = e.fields['issbn']
else:
issbn = ""
return issbn
def get_note(self, e):
if 'note' in e.fields.keys():
note = e.fields['note']
else:
note = ""
return note
def get_url(self, e):
if "url" in e.fields.keys() and len(e.fields['url']) > 0:
link = e.fields['url']
else:
link = "?"
return link
def get_editors_short(self, e):
if "editor" in e.persons.keys():
editors = self.get_people_short(e.persons['editor'])
else:
editors = ""
return editors
def get_editors_full(self, e):
if "editor" in e.persons.keys():
editors = self.get_people_full(e.persons['editor'])
else:
editors = ""
return editors
def get_authors_short(self, e):
if "author" in e.persons.keys():
authors = self.get_people_short(e.persons['author'])
else:
authors = ""
return authors
def get_authors_full(self, e):
if "author" in e.persons.keys():
authors = self.get_people_full(e.persons['author'])
else:
authors = ""
return authors
def citation_short_output(self, id, link=None):
e = self.citation_entry(id)
link = self.get_url(e)
authors = self.get_authors_short(e)
title = self.get_title(e)
year = self.get_pubYear(e)
edition = self.get_edition(e)
publisher = self.get_publisher(e)
output = '<li id="{eid}"><a href="{link}" class="litref">{authors} ({pubYear}).</a> <em>{title}</em>{edition}. {publisher}'.format(eid = id, link = link, authors = authors, pubYear = year, title = title, edition = edition, publisher = publisher)
return output
def citation_full_output(self, id):
e = self.citation_entry(id)
link = self.get_url(e)
authors = self.get_authors_full(e)
editors = self.get_editors_full(e)
title = self.get_title(e)
year = self.get_pubYear(e)
edition = self.get_edition(e)
pages = self.get_pages(e)
issbn = self.get_issbn(e)
note = self.get_note(e)
publisher = self.get_publisher(e)
output = """<h2>{title}</h2><h3>{authors} ({pubYear})</h3>
<p>{note}</p>
<dl class="literature">
<dt class="edition"></dt>
<dd>{edition}</dd>
<dt class="editors"></dt>
<dd>{editors}</dd>
<dt class="pages"></dt>
<dd>{pages}</dd>
<dt class="issbn"></dt>
<dd>{issbn}</dd>
<dt class="publisher"></dt>
<dd>{publisher}</dd>
</dl>
""".format(eid = id, link = link, authors = authors, pubYear = year, title = title, edition = edition, publisher = publisher, editors = editors, pages = pages, issbn = issbn, note = note)
return output
def citation_base_cite(self,id,link="",output=""):
e = self.citation_entry(id)
if len(link) > 1:
link = link
elif self.default_prio == "url":
link = self.get_url(e)
if len(link) < 2:
link = self.default_link
else:
link = self.default_link
authors = self.get_authors_short(e)
year = self.get_pubYear(e)
output = output.format(link = link, id = id, authors = authors, pubYear = year)
return output
def citation_full_cite(self,id,link=""):
output = self.citation_base_cite(id,link="",output="""<a href=\"{link}#{id}\" class=\"litref\">({authors}, {pubYear})</a>""")
return output
def citation_full_citeNP(self,id,link=""):
output = self.citation_base_cite(id,link="",output="""<a href=\"{link}#{id}\" class=\"litref\">{authors} ({pubYear})</a>""")
return output
def on_setup_env(self, **extra):
def decode_filter(value):
""" Make sure that special chars like german umlaute or accents are displayed in unicode """
return LatexNodes2Text().latex_to_text(value.replace(" & ", " \& "))
self.env.jinja_env.globals['citation_entries'] = self.citation_entries
self.env.jinja_env.globals['citation_entry'] = self.citation_entry
self.env.jinja_env.globals['citation_short_output'] = self.citation_short_output
self.env.jinja_env.globals['citation_full_output'] = self.citation_full_output
self.env.jinja_env.globals['citation_full_cite'] = self.citation_full_cite
self.env.jinja_env.globals['citation_full_citeNP'] = self.citation_full_citeNP
self.env.jinja_env.globals['citation_authors_short'] = self.get_authors_short
self.env.jinja_env.globals['citation_authors_full'] = self.get_authors_full
self.env.jinja_env.globals['citation_editors_short'] = self.get_editors_short
self.env.jinja_env.globals['citation_editors_full'] = self.get_editors_full
self.env.jinja_env.globals['citation_pubYear'] = self.get_pubYear
self.env.jinja_env.globals['citation_edition'] = self.get_edition
self.env.jinja_env.globals['citation_publisher'] = self.get_publisher
self.env.jinja_env.globals['citation_title'] = self.get_title
self.env.jinja_env.globals['citation_url'] = self.get_url
self.env.jinja_env.globals['citation_issbn'] = self.get_issbn
self.env.jinja_env.globals['citation_pages'] = self.get_pages
self.env.jinja_env.globals['citation_note'] = self.get_note
self.env.jinja_env.filters['decode'] = decode_filter
